Story Description

"I know who you are."
"No you don't."
"I'm coming after you."
"No you won't."
"Watch me."

Special FBI agent Jay Fletcher knows how to catch serial killers. She's developed a computer program that identifies the most vicious murderers in
America.

But Jay's
Washington bosses have told her to stop. She can't use her program. It violates the Constitution. It violates these sick killers' civil rights.

Now Jay's been transferred to a tiny office in Sante Fe. She's instructed to stay out of multiple murder cases. As far as
Washington knows, she is.

Like hell she is.

Jay is going on-line.
She's going to track down the killers.
What will she do when she finds them?
She says...watch me.

Reviewing

Ethical dilemma fuels hacker thriller     Holt's debut thriller features FBI agent and computer hacker Janet (Jay) Fletcher, whose zeal doesn't always follow proper legal channels. When her illegally obtained evidence blows a murder case, she is assigned to an arson detail in Santa Fe. But she can't help running her computer tracking system to find a local serial killer.

Find him she does but her methods are not court admissable. Agonizing over what to do, she finds herself face-to-face with the killer - and evidence of an on-line network of people like himself - serial killers who've made a game out of ritualistic murder.

Holt knows computers, and uses this fantastic scenario to dazzle rather than confuse the reader. The action never flags but even more interesting is the ethical nail-biting. With expert manipulation, Holt fires the reader emotionally with gruesome murder scenes then asks "What's more important - stopping a serial killer or obeying the law?" And to really make it disturbing, Fletcher begins to get a thrill out of her rogue vigilantism. Exciting from first page to last.

Industry reviews
The line between good and evil vanishes in this debut thriller about serial killers who talk shop on the Internet and the vigilante FBI agent who chases them through cyberspace. Talented agent Jay Fletcher holds graduate degrees in psychology and computer science and has even designed a computer template for the FBI. When her zealousness compromises a case, she's packed off to Santa Fe to cool her heels. While participating in an arson investigation, Jay stumbles onto "Special K," an Internet game for serial killers. One killer looks like and obsesses about Leonard Nimoy. Another, aptly named Iceman by the FBI, parasitically lives off the identities and credit cards of his victims. This grisly, disturbing, yet fresh novel raises numerous complex questions for our high-tech society. Highly recommended for all fiction collections; most libraries can expect requests. [Previewed in Prepub Alert, LJ 6/15/95.] Susan A. Zappia, Maricopa Cty. Lib. Dist., Phoenix
